Abstract

In this paper, the leaves of Indocalamus herklotsii, Indocalamus decorus, and Indocala-mus latifolius were collected from Nanjing in different seasons to study the seasonal changes of the total flavonoids, tea polyphenols, and soluble sugar contents in the leaves. There existed significant differences in the test active ingredients contents among the leaves of the three Indocalamus species. The leaf total flavonoids content of the three Indocalamus species in different seasons ranged in 1. 7%-2. 7% , being the highest for /. herklotsii and /. decorus in spring and for /. latifolius in winter. The leaf tea polyphenols content varied from 5.5% to 7. 6% ; and the leaf soluble sugar content was 1.0% -8. 5% , with the maximum in spring. Within the three months after leaf unfol-ding, the active ingredients contents in /. herklotsii and /. decorus leaves increased with leaf age. The optimal period for harvesting Indocalamus leaves was from December to next March. Among the three Indocalamus species, /. latifolius had the highest contents of the three active ingredients in leaves, suggesting that /. latifolius had greater potential value in the utilization of its leaf active in-gredients than the other two species.
